The Morgan Library and Museum in New York City will be hosting the Tolkien: Maker of Middle-earth exhibition from January to May 2019 after its initial run in the Bodleian Museum in the UK later this year.

The following important details have been confirmed so far:
  • The exhibition will be slightly smaller - not all shown in the UK will make the trip to the USA for the exhibition
  • The regular museum admission is required to see the exhibition (currently this is $20 per adult). The Bodleian exhibition is free admission
  • The Bodleian exhibition catalog will be available to purchase at the Morgan exhibition, along with other Tolkien related books and merchandise

[UPDATE] The Morgan will not be showing items related to Tolkien's other writings, such as Roverandom, nor his academic work. Also, there are more family items in the Bodleian exhibition that won't be traveling to New York. They will be showing, however, the majority of items related to The Hobbit, The Lord of the Rings, and The Silmarillion.​
